Transaction 95fc6c0774ce815f68553fd5d350204e8be19fbe03c9664b12a5c496610d1b90
1 Input
1 Output
-
95fc6c0774ce815f68553fd5d350204e8be19fbe03c9664b12a5c496610d1b90:0
- value
- 193860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de12af31b86bd2fbae81734615db4b5f514ec099 OP_EQUAL
- address
- 3MwEKLme4YjtLmxE9CEsWQAYKNRnuR8a5s